Camp Scully

Camp Scully is a co-ed; day and overnight summer camp for children and teens aged 5 to 17 and is accredited by the American Camp Association.  It is located on 22 acres of land on Snyder’s Lake in North Greenbush, approximately 10 miles from Albany, New York.  Campers spend their week with 9 other children in their age group and two adult counselors. Cabins are split by gender and are in separate areas of the camp.

Camp Scully has nine children’s cabins, playing fields, hiking trails, a beach area, and an archery field, challenge ropes course, campfire pits, game areas, a vegetable garden, a stage, a lean-to camping platform, and a recreation hall.  New this year is our Nature/ Environmental center, the children explore and learn about a variety of local animal wildlife that frequents the grounds. They view animal pelts, skeletons, and look at reference material of local animal life for identifications purposes.
In the center there will an ant farm, a worm factory, a water cycle model, a variety of rocks (sedimentary, igneous, and metamorphic), and photosynthesis information and models.

Camp has an extensive waterfront area with a Pirate Boat, kayaks, canoes and an inflatable water trampoline. Our challenge ropes course is an extensive one with plenty of physical and mental obstacles for children including two lines 30 feet in the air. Camp has two archery ranges, a beginner range and a more advanced one with a unique “sniper” trail!
